Wilpattu National Park

Wilpattu National Park

39.52km from Kalpitiya Dutch Church

Wilpattu National Park is located 26 km north of Puttalam. With an area of 131,693 hectares Wilpattu National Park is the largest and oldest wildlife sanctuary in Sri Lanka. The park features more than 50 wetlands, 31 species of mammals, and countless species of birds.

Archaeological Museum Anuradhapura

Archaeological Museum Anuradhapura

70.27km from Kalpitiya Dutch Church

It is also known as Puravidu Bhavana, one of the archaeological museums in North Central Province. The museum was established in 1947 under the prime effort of Dr. Senarath Paranavithana. It is one of the oldest museums.

Abhayagiri Dagaba

Abhayagiri Dagaba

70.95km from Kalpitiya Dutch Church

Abhayagiri Vihāra was a primary religious site in Mahayana, Theravada and Vajrayana Buddhism located in Anuradhapura, Sri Lanka and it is one of the most extensive ruins in the world. It is one of the holiest Buddhist pilgrimage cities in the country.

Sri Munneswaram Devasthanam

Sri Munneswaram Devasthanam

73.22km from Kalpitiya Dutch Church

This temple is a famous regional Hindu temple complex in Sri Lanka. It has been in existence at least since 1000 CE. The complex has a collection of five temples, including a Buddhist temple.

Mannar Island

Mannar Island

91.5km from Kalpitiya Dutch Church

Mannar Island located in the Northern province in Sri Lanka, the island is best known for the sunny weather, palm trees, and the and large areas of white sands. It is recommended to visit the island between July and September.

Kalpitiya Dutch Church

Kalpitiya Dutch Church

mutuwal street kalpitiya, Kalpitiya, Sri Lanka

It is also known as St Peter's Kerk, located between the Dutch fort and the village of Kalpitiya. The church was built in 1706 by the Dutch and is a smaller version of the church in Matara fort. It is one of the earliest protestant churches in the country.
